Summary: | Cervical margin of fixed denture either jacket crown or bridge, is usually placed
subgingivally for the natural look, however this can sometimes cause gingival
inflammation. Moreover, if the restoration material is acrylic, it sometimes can irritate
oral tissue. The aim of this study was to investigate the effect of acrylic, used as fixed
denture material, to gingival tissue reaction. This was an experimental study, using pre
and post test of 5 acrylic jacket crowns, made to patients in the Prosthodontic
Department, Dental Hospital of Hasanuddin University. Gingival crevicular fluid (GCF)
was collected before preparation, and three weeks after insertion of the jacket crowns,
then pro-inflammatory cytokines; TNF-α and IL-1β were examined. The results analyzed
by Wilcoxon sign rank test (p<0.05). The results showed the elevation of TNF-α and IL1β
concentration after acrylic jacket crown insertion compare with the concentration
before preparation. The conclusion of this study is acrylic restoration material may cause
gingival inflammation. |
